Holiday Trading Dynamics

Holiday trading can be quite volatile due to the lower volume of trading activity. During the holiday season, many investors take a break from the markets, leading to reduced liquidity and potentially higher price volatility. This makes it crucial for investors to stay informed about market trends and make strategic decisions.

Key Factors to Consider During Holiday Trading

  1. Market Trends: It's essential to stay updated with market trends and economic indicators to make informed decisions.
  2. Company News: Keep an eye on any company-specific news that could impact the stock's performance.
  3. Liquidity: Be aware of the stock's liquidity, as lower liquidity can lead to wider bid-ask spreads and higher transaction costs.
